English The obiect of the English Depart- ment is to help students to become well versed in English and related subiects. Courses offered by this department include the study of literature, both classic and mo- dern, grammar, and writing skills, all of which are important through- out the life of the student. English 81 Citizenship Education This division of the H. Frank Carey High School teaching staff gives the students a background in English and Citizenship Education, thus preparing them for the same subiects on a senior high level.

Science With engineering as important as it is today, our science department serves an important purpose, pro- viding the basic skills for our future engineers, through such courses as Chemistry, Physics and Earth Science. Not to be forgotten is Biology, an important course for all college bound students.
